In order to be licensed as a professional kickboxer or mixed martial arts contestant for an event or exhibition, an applicant:

(1)must be between the ages of eighteen and thirty-five, unless the commission by a majority vote waives this requirement as to an individual applicant over the age of thirty-five;
(2)shall submit a completed application with payment of the prescribed fee; and (3) shall submit documentation, on a commission-approved form, that the applicant has undergone a comprehensive physical examination by a licensed physician subsequent to his last match or fifteen days before an event or exhibition in this State.
